Forge for 1.7.10 (Build 1558+) is exclusive in its architecture. Unlike modern Forge, which requires a "Mod Launcher" proxy, 1.7.10 Forge patches the game at runtime natively. This allows for "core mods" that edit Minecraft’s source code while the game is running—a practice Mojang has since heavily discouraged.

It is important to remember that this era was the defining separation between Console and PC. In 2014, the "Better Together" update (Bedrock) was years away.
The "Java Version Exclusive" wasn't just a marketing tagline; it was a reality. Console players looked on with envy at the massive modpacks, the custom shaders, and the infinite worlds of Java 1.7.10. This version solidified Java Edition as the "Creator's Platform."
